Top Tobacco Companies In India You Need To Know About

  • ITC is the largest tobacco company in India that holds 77% market share in tobacco market and generates 40% revenue from it
  • Other top tobacco companies in India are Godfrey Phillips India, VST industries, NTC industries, Kothari products etc

We all know that smoking is injurious to health as it causes cancer. There’s heavy taxation on tobacco products in India but still India is one of the largest countries with smokers. Estimates suggest that there are 120 million smokers in India while total tobacco users stand at 267 million. Before we move to companies you should know that Kolkata is the city with highest number of smokers. Around 56% population of this city smokes. In recent report Chhattisgarh is the state with highest number of tobacco users, Karnataka too is not far behind. On 22 October 2002 smoking in public places was banned in India.

ITC Limited

Earlier ITC stands for India Tobacco Company (1970 – 1974) but to move away from tobacco business its name was eventually changed to ITC Limited (1974 – present). It is the largest tobacco company in India that holds 77% market share in tobacco market. ITC is the world’s 8th largest cigarette company as well.

Every quarter ITC generates more than ₹7,000 crore revenue for cigarette business only which is 40% of the company’s revenue. ITC manufactures cigarettes in 5 cities – Pune, Bengaluru, Munger, Saharanpur and Kolkata.

ITC has strong portfolio of multiple cigarette and cigar brands which includes – Insignia, India Kings, Classic, Gold Flake, American Club, Wills Navy Cut, Players, Scissors, Capstan, Berkeley, Bristol, Flake, Silk Cut, Duke & Royal.

Godfrey Phillips India Limited

The 2nd company here is Godfrey Phillips India Limited. The company has a turnover of ₹2000+ crores and it was originally established in London in 1844. This company is owned by Modi Enterprises based in New Delhi.

Populary known as GPI (Godfrey Phillips India), the company has partnership with American multinational Philip Morris International for selling Marlboro cigarettes in India. Apart from this GPI has Cavanders, Four Square, Red & White, Stellar, North Pole and Tipper cigarette brands in its portfolio. Pan Vilas is owned by them.

VST Industries Limited

One of the top tobacco companies in India is VAT Industries Limited based in Hyderabad. It was founded in 1930 as Vazir Sultan Tobacco Company Limited. This company is an associate undertaking of British American Tobacco Group. In 1983 it became fully independent and registered as VST Industries through British American Tobacco subsidiaries.

VST Industries generates close to ₹2000 crore revenue every year. The Company sells Charminar Specials, Shah-I- Deccan, Charms Virginia Filter Kings, Vazir, Qila and Ambassador cigarette brands. Particularly in Telangana company’s products are immensely popular. VST Industries also sells its products in international markets.

Kothari Products Ltd

Pan Parag is one of the most popular Pan Masala brand in India. It was launched in 1973 and is the flagship product of Kothari Group Ltd. Late Shri Mansukhbhai Kothari pioneered Pan Parag and today it is a household name. In 2022 the company’s revenue stood at ₹3396 crore.

Golden Tobacco Ltd

Taken over by the Dalmia Group in 1979 the Golden Tobacco Limited was started in 1930 by Shri. Narsee Monjee. It sells Panama, Chancellor, Golden’s Gold Flake and Taj Chhap cigarettes in India. Apart from this the company is one of the largest exporters of cigars & cigarettes from India. Company’s revenue in 2021 stood at ₹41 crore.

NTC Industries Limited

In list of top tobacco companies in India the last company is NTC Industries limited. Headquartered in Kolkata the company was founded in 1931 and it is one of the oldest cigarette manufacturers in India. In Brussels, Rotterdam, Amsterdam, Paris and Luxemburg NTC Industries sells its products.

NTC Industries cigarette brands includes Regent, Regent Special, Maypole, Prestige, Macpole and Jaipur. The company’s annual revenue stood at ₹31 crore in 2022 while profits were at ₹9 crore.
